SAP (ETR:SAP) Shares Cross Above 200 Day Moving Average – Here’s Why

SAP SE (ETR:SAPGet Free Report) shares crossed above its 200-day moving average during trading on Monday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of €156.23 and traded as high as €158.26. SAP shares last traded at €157.68, with a volume of 3,541,483 shares changing hands.

About SAP

(Get Free Report)

SAP SE, together with its subsidiaries, provides applications, technology, and services worldwide. It offers SAP S/4HANA that provides software capabilities for finance, risk and project management, procurement, manufacturing, supply chain and asset management, and research and development; SAP SuccessFactors solutions for human resources, including HR and payroll, talent and employee experience management, and people and workforce analytics; and spend management solutions that covers direct and indirect spend, travel and expense, and external workforce management.
